Overview
Marukoma Onsen Ryokan Chitose offers 14 rooms in the vicinity of Lake Shikotsu, around 100 metres away. The hotel offers a private as well as parking.
Location
Guests may find Lake Shikotsu 10 minutes' drive from this 3-star hotel, and Poropinai Observatory Observation Deck is 3 km away.
For those travelling from afar, New Chitose airport is 49 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
Some rooms provide a minibar and an electric kettle as well as a flat-screen TV with satellite channels to help you enjoy your stay. They have a Japanese interior. The shared bathrooms are appointed with bath sheets and slippers.
Eat & Drink
The Marukoma offers an à la carte restaurant serving European cuisine.
Leisure & Business
A hot spring public bath and a sauna are available on site.
